I posted my first post on the General board yesterday. The whole thing was very therapeutic. I've had clusters for 27 years. They were chronic for 20 years. Had a heart attack 4.5 years ago and they stopped.  A month ago they returned. Now my doc won't give me Imitrex or anything else with ergotamine - which was always the only thin that worked.
 
Does anyone else have a heart condition and CH?  What does your doc give you?

While Imitrex has a good safety profile there are sufficient negative outcomes to warrant your doc's stance given your heart condition.
 
Agree, that preventive meds is the best approach.
 
I have reported here (several months ago) excellent results using Zyprexa (olanzapine), 5mg, to abort attacks. After using Ergomar for many years it disappeared from the market and I tried the Zyprexa in desperation. It proved to work as quickly but more consistently than Ergomar.

I just wont to add my medications for breaking out of cycle.But remember that i`m not a doc,just another clusterhead from Norway  
   
Verapamil Retard 120mgX5-7/daily during cycle    
Oxygene alone at 10ltm for 15 minutes or combined with imitrex-shots does miracles.The shots should start working in 6-9minutes.a few secons after that you are almost painfree    
Prednisolone in high doze for 10 days 80mg    
then over a 3 weeks periode step down like 60-40-30-20-10-5mg /daily    
     
This is the miraclecure for me,but i`m not a doc.just another clusterhead from Norway    
 
I also have a bad heartcondition.Had a heartattack Nov 12.But quitting the shots is no option for me.I think that the shots is Gods gift to us clusterheads.  
The thing that i don`t understand or found the answer to is how i after the attack has had only 9 light clusterattacks."singleattacks"And before i was diagnosed as a cronical.
